The 2017 Society of Vineyard Scholars conference will be held on June 22-24, 2017. It will be hosted by Elm City Vineyard, a dynamic, diverse, urban church in the heart of New Haven, CT. All meetings will be held on the beautiful campus of Yale Divinity School.

Confirmed plenary speakers include Miroslav Volf and Willie James Jennings, two of the most vital, public-minded, and churchly theologians of our time. We are truly honored to have them both with us. Further speakers, worship leaders, and special events will be announced soon.

The CALL FOR PAPERS, which will be released on December 1st, 2016, will center on themes connecting the Kingdom of God to the public witness of the Church.
